Stainless Steel Low Pressure Shuttle Valve

The VERSA low-pressure Shuttle Valves are constructed of 316 stainless steel with resilient seals providing tight shut-off. Shuttle Valves are 3/2 valves primarily used to charge and discharge a pressure line or chamber from two - or more - sources. When a pressure signal enters the port blocked by the shuttle, it will cause the shuttle to shift toward the lower pressure port.

Product Features

  • Constructed of SAE 316 stainless steel conforming to NACE standard MR-01-75 suitable for direct exposure to sour environments
  • FKM o-ring seals perform reliably with exposure to hydrocarbons or highly corrosive fluids over a broad temperature range: equivalent to Viton®, Fluorel®
